COURSE OF THE MONTH
Automated External Defibrillator ( AED )
Want to take your basic life support skills to a higher level and be able to give a non-breathing , unresponsive casualty an increased chance of survival ?
Automated External Defibrillators ( AEDs ) are becoming widely available for use in an emergency in public places and during this course you will gain the skills and confidence to use one .
The AED course is open to all members aged 12 or above , with up-to-date basic life support skills . This could be from Sports Diver training or attendance at a BSAC Oxygen Administration SDC . All divers are encouraged to take this course .
The two-and-a-half-hour course explains what an AED is and gives you experience using an AED in a training environment . Through a structured range of scenarios , you will receive plenty of hands-on practice of when and how to use an AED .
You will learn how to use an AED in accordance with Resuscitation Council ( UK ) Guidelines . You will be qualified to use an AED in diving environments . If you are at the scene of an emergency in a public place , such as an airport or station , you will have skills to be able to use an AED if one is available .
Practical sessions are supported by theory sessions on the heart and its rhythms , choosing and using an AED machine , and safety procedures specific to using an AED in diving situations . This is a continually assessed course during which students must reach the required performance standards .
Dave Parry from Chester SAC , said : “ After taking this course you will be able to confidently use an AED unit on a dive trip in an emergency , plus use the skills you ’ ve learned for the wider community as well . Highly recommended .” You can find out more at bsac . com / aed
